Hi I am 37 mother of 3 youngest is 13...I found out in March that I was pregnant only to miscarry in April...I had a complete miscarriage NO D&C needed...I started my normal cycle on May 13th...I am trying to pinpoint when will or IF i have already ovulated.....I am sure I have atleast a 31 day cycle...I started having mild cramps around the 20th and I am assuming these are ovulation cramps? Me and my husband has sex twice on the 21st and once on the 22nd.....today my breasts are sore which im assuming this is another sign of ovulation? He is out of town until Friday so Im afraid I will miss my ovulation window unless I ovulated early...Could someone please give me some advice....I know I have 3 kids already but tracking and planning are all new to me...so I dont really know what to look for and how to do it..but we absolutely want another baby...

Hi! I have had a look at your dates in an ovulation calculator and your fertile dates were given as Thursday 27 May to Tuesday 1 Jun. Obviously, this is just an estimation but ovulation is usually occurs 14 days before your next period is due. Good luck
